Understanding Niche Insurance for Specialty Medical Clinics
Niche insurance for specialty medical clinics is a tailored approach to meeting the unique risk management needs of these specialized healthcare facilities. In contrast to one-size-fits-all insurance policies, custom insurance for specialty healthcare considers the specific services, equipment, and patient populations managed by each clinic. This means comprehensive coverage that addresses the particular risks associated with their operations, such as complex medical procedures, rare conditions, and specialized treatments.
Specialty medical clinics often face distinct challenges due to their focused practices. Customized insurance policies account for these nuances, ensuring adequate protection against potential liabilities, property damage, professional errors, and omissions. By understanding the clinic’s specific risks, insurers can design coverage that offers peace of mind, allowing healthcare professionals to focus on patient care without constant worry about financial exposure.

Identifying Risks Specific to Specialty Clinics
Specialty medical clinics face unique challenges when it comes to risk management due to their specialized nature and often complex patient demographics. Identifying risks specific to these clinics is an essential step in developing tailored insurance solutions, which we refer to as custom insurance for specialty healthcare.
One significant risk factor is the potential for high-dollar liability claims resulting from rare or complex medical procedures. These clinics often treat patients with specific conditions that require specialized care, and any adverse outcomes can lead to substantial legal repercussions. Additionally, workforce-related risks are prevalent, including malpractice suits arising from errors in patient records, medication administration, or other administrative oversights. Custom insurance policies must address these perils by offering adequate coverage limits and specific exclusions or modifications tailored to the clinic’s unique practices.
